Projection electron-beam lithography masks using advanced materials and membrane size

A stencil or scatterer mask for use with charged particle beam lithography such as projection electron-beam lithography comprises a membrane layer of a material having a Young's modulus of at least about 400 GPa and support struts supporting a surface of the membrane. The struts form and surrounding a plurality of discrete membrane areas of different aspect ratios aligned to design regions of an integrated circuit. The discrete membrane areas have different aspect ratios range from about 1:1 to about 12:1, and the discrete membrane areas have different size surface areas. The membrane is preferably silicon carbide, diamond, diamond-like carbon, amorphous carbon, carbon nitride or boron nitride. When used in scatterer masks, the ratio of discrete membrane area to membrane thickness is at least about 0.18 mm2/nm. When used in stencil masks, the ratio of discrete membrane area to membrane thickness is at least about 1.0 mm2/nm. The stencil mask is made by depositing a diamond membrane film patterned with a hardmask layer on a substrate, depositing an etch stop layer adjacent the diamond film, and forming supporting struts surrounding a plurality of discrete areas of the membrane film. The method then includes depositing a pattern over the membrane film within the discrete membrane film areas, the pattern conforming to one or more desired circuit elements, and etching the membrane film with a reactive ion etch containing oxygen to form openings in the membrane film.

Method for producing liquid core microcapsule by electrostatic spraying

The invention provides a method for preparation of liquid core microcapsule with static sprayer: calcium chloride solution of 2-3 percent is mixed with thickening agent and then is uniformly mixed with core material substance; a certain amount of mixed solution is taken out and then is put into solution containing sodium alginate of 0.6-1.5 percent with static sprayer while adopting a flat needle for adhesive deposite or an injection needle as a nozzle; after capsulated, liquid core sodium alginate microcapsule is filtered and then is cleaned with purified water; then liquid core sodium alginate microcapsule is put into calcium chloride solution for continuous solidification of 5-10 minutes; then microcapsule is filtered and then is cleaned with purified water; at last microcapsule is stored in storage solution with calcium ion concentration of 0.05-0.01 percent. High viscosity malt dextrin or sodium carbonxymethyl cellulose or xanthan gum is adopted as thickening agent. Microcapsule prepared with the invention has liquid core, with uniform particle size, good sacculation performance, simple process and high membrane thickness, therefore, microcapsule has high mechanical strength and can be widely used in the field of pharmaceutical chemical engineering, artificial organ implantation and food processing, etc.

Citric acid-chitosan-modified anticoagulation polyurethane blood dialysis membrane and preparation method thereof

The invention discloses a citric acid-chitosan-modified anticoagulation polyurethane blood dialysis membrane and a preparation method thereof. The membrane is of a hollow fibrous structure, and the inner surface and outer surface are dense cortical layers, and the middle is a porous supporting layer, so that the blood dialysis membrane is high in permeability and separating property and antibacterial property; the inner diameter is 160 to 250mu m; the membrane thickness is 30 to 50 mu m, and the ultrafiltration coefficient is 7.0 to 60 ml/m<2>.h.mmHg; citric acid-chitosan-modified anticoagulation polyurethane is taken as membrane materials, and in membrane solution, the percentage mass content of the modified anticoagulation polyurethane is 15 to 30%, and the percentage mass content of a solvent is 70 to 85%, and the blood dialysis membrane is prepared by using a nonsolvent induced phase separation method. The preparation process of the dialysis membrane is simple and easy to control, and the prepared membrane has good anticoagulant activity, biocompatibility and antibacterial property, and the clearance rates of urea, beta2-microglobulin and albumin are respectively 55 to 80%, 48 to 60%, and 2.5 to 9%, and the rate of resisting pathogenic escherichia coli is 99%.

Technology for producing wood-like aluminium alloy section bar with environmental protection and super weatherability

The invention relates to a technology for producing wood-like aluminium alloy section bar with environmental protection and super weatherability, which comprises the following steps: grounding, removing oil by employing sulfuric acid; performing alkali corrosion by employing NaOH; neutralizing in a neutralization groove, wherein a liquid in the neutralization groove is a mixture of sulfuric acid and nitric acid; performing anodization, wherein an aluminium alloy section bar is introduced in an oxidation, and liquid in the oxidation groove is energized for oxidation; performing electrolytic coloring, wherein the aluminium alloy section bar is introduced in a coloring groove, the coloring groove is energized for coloring; performing electrophoresis; detecting, and pasting the wood grain. The average oxide-film thickness is greater than or equal to 6mum, the average electrophoresis paint film thickness is greater than or equal to 20mum, and average conposite membrane thickness is greater than or equal to 26mum. The product has the advantages of good weatherability and corrosion resistance with 9.8 grade, luster maintenance rate can reach more than 95%, color losing is not generated on surface after weatherability tests on surface, and the wood-like aluminium alloy section bar is suitable for all building door and windows, curtain walls and indoor decoration.

Method for preparing lanthanum nickel oxide thin-film material

The invention discloses a method for preparing lanthanum nickel oxide thin-film materials. The method comprises the following steps: weighing nickel acetate and lanthanum acetate according to 1:1 of molar ratio of nickel to lanthanum; respectively adding the nickel acetate and lanthanum acetate into propanoic acid which is taken as a solvent; respectively stirring for 10-30min at the temperature of 40-70 DEG C to obtain nickel acetate solution; adding lanthanum acetate to the nickel acetate solution; stirring the solution at the temperature of 40-70 DEG C; stirring to transparent state at room temperature to obtain the mixed solution; filtering the mixed solution to obtain a precursor colloid of the lanthanum nickel oxide; placing the precursor colloid of the lanthanum nickel oxide on a substrate to rotatably spray into a gel membrane, then pyrolyzing the gel membrane for 15-30min at the temperature of 300-450 DEG C; repeating the above steps until the pyrolysis membrane with needed thickness is acquired; finally, placing the pyrolysis membrane at the temperature of 600-750 DEG C for annealing for 60-240min to prepare into the lanthanum nickel oxide thin-film material with the membrane thickness of 10nm-1mu m, wherein the material has wide application prospects in the fields, such as membrane materials, information materials, superconducting materials and the like.
